Contempora­ry in Clare

Pemberley in Ballymorri­s, near Cratloe in Co Clare, is a modern family home in a gated enclave of detached homes, located a 15-minute drive from Shannon Airport. The architect-designed house was built in 2005 and is ideal for a growing family. Pemberley has well-proportion­ed, bright rooms with an open-plan layout, as well as four en suite double bedrooms. The property is in immaculate condition and stylishly decorated. Features include Italian marble tiles, a solid wood bespoke fitted kitchen, hand-carved staircase, solid oak floors and attractive moulded architrave­s and skirtings. The house has 355sqm of living space and stands on a private threequart­ers of an acre site with a south-facing rear garden.

Knocknagin House, near Balbriggan in Co Dublin, is a French-style, period country house dating from circa 1680. The house is coming down with charm and character, and is set amidst wonderful gardens and an attractive stream, within walking distance of a sandy beach. Knocknagin is located beside Delvin Bridge, on the R132 running between Drogheda and Dublin Airport, just off the Ml. The house was virtually rebuilt in 1994, using as much original and local material as possible, and finished to a high standard. The two-storey, three-bay central block has an attic floor and a wing attached to each gable. There is potential for further developmen­t — perhaps as a guest-house or wedding venue — subject to planning permission, with tax credits available for future refurbishm­ent works.

Charming in Cork

Hitherto at Ballinhass­ig, Inishannon, Co Cork, is a four-bedroom family home built 15 years ago in the style of a period residence in terms of its layout and design, high ceilings, room proportion­s and overall character. The property is in excellent condition and has particular­ly fine floors in solid French oak. Two of the four bedrooms are en suite and there is a detached garage. The house sits on half an acre of mature gardens in a scenic and peaceful location with views over the surroundin­g countrysid­e. Positioned a short distance off the N71 between Innishanno­n Village and Ballinhass­ig, and 20 minutes from Bishopstow­n, there is easy access to CUH, Cork Airport, Innishanno­n and Kinsale.

Delightful in Donegal

Drung is a modern house in an elevated coastal position with spectacula­r sea views located near Redcastle, Co Donegal, on the Inishowen Peninsula, 29km from City of Derry Airport. The house, which was built in 1993, has recently been refurbishe­d and renovated and has 184sqm of living space. On the ground floor, there is an entrance hall, dining room, sitting room with open fire and study, which could be used as a fifth bedroom. There is also a large openplan kitchen/ living space, utility room and guest loo. Upstairs there are three double bedrooms and one single. The main bedroom is en suite and there is a family bathroom. Redcastle has a sandy beach and a world-renowned golf course.
